WebApr 5, 2024 · A truss bridge is a type of bridge that utilizes trusses, a form of rigid frames that use webbed triangular structures to support the bridge deck (the driving surface). Truss bridges are designed to span greater lengths than conventional bridge designs. They are commonly used to carry both rail and road traffic. WebThere are numerous wood and metal truss types. The wooden Bunker Hill Bridge is a Haupt truss, a type invented in 1839. There are many types or subtypes of metal truss … WebNov 2, 2024 · There are many types of truss designs that can be used for construction. They are the Allan, Bailey, Baltimore, Bollman, Bowstring, Brown, Howe, Lattice, Lenticular, Pennsylvania, Pratt, and many other designs. One of the most interesting construction types is Pratt. This type of design was used extensively during World War II.

WebA Vierendeel bridge is a bridge employing a Vierendeel truss, named after Arthur Vierendeel.
